Training Objectives Telecommunications and computer networks are at the heart of the digital transformation reshaping all sectors of activity. The convergence of voice, data, and video services, combined with the rapid evolution of Internet technologies, mobile communications, and cloud infrastructures, requires high-level expertise to design, deploy, and secure complex communication systems. This Master’s program in Networks and Telecommunications responds to these growing needs by providing advanced scientific and technical training in the architecture, administration, and optimization of modern communication networks. It builds upon the solid foundations acquired during the Bachelor’s degree in Telecommunications, where students were introduced to essential modules such as Wave Propagation, Signal Processing, Analog and Digital Communications, Transmission Media, Propagation and Antennas, and Computer Networks. At the Master’s level, the focus shifts toward advanced design, integration, and management of networked systems. Students explore modules such as IP Routing, Standards and Protocols, Advanced Signal Processing, Advanced Digital Communications, Linux Systems, and Advanced Programming (Python), which enable them to address the challenges of emerging technologies such as 5G/6G, IoT, and cloud-based infrastructures. Additional courses such as Network Administration, High-Speed Networks, Satellite Networks, Transmission Channels, Coding and Compression, DSP and FPGA Systems, and Optical Fiber Installation and Maintenance develop both practical and theoretical expertise.
